I can't specificly help you, but I recognize one thing in there that
you'll have to look out for as well.

By low-profile mounting bracket, it sounds like you are looking for
a card that can go into a server as well.
Years back, almost all PCIe sound cards I could find were 5V only cards.
Almost all servers are 3.3V only PCIe buses.

Are you sure you can't use a USB connected sound box?

That is what I ended up with in the past. It was either that, or to
use a desktop box.
